Prueba Velneo Gratis

Te ofrecemos todo el poder de Velneo durante 1 mes para desarrollar la aplicación que tu empresa necesita.

Saber más
Thank you! Check your email for confirmation.

¿Está optimizado el diseño de mi rejilla?

Al igual que las tablas, el buen diseño de una rejilla puede afectar al rendimiento de nuestras aplicaciones en la nube.Las rejillas suelen ser elementos habituales en las aplicaciones y un buen diseño nos permitirá que nuestras aplicaciones vuelen.Cuando creemos nuestras rejillas debemos tener en cuenta una serie de factores que nos evitarán tiempos de espera innecesarios.

  • Evitar el uso de campos puntero indirecto o hermano contiguo.Este tipo de campos deben ser recalculados continuamente debido a que su valor depende a una posición en un índice, esto provoca que Velneo deba consultar al servidor el campo para garantizar un valor correcto. Los registros son cacheados con lo que solo viajan del servidor una sola vez.
  • Evitar el uso de fórmulas que contengan operaciones con objeto texto.Los objeto texto, junto las imágenes o los maestros son cargados en segundo plano. Si estos campos objeto texto necesitan ser procesados por una fórmula fLower(#CAMPOOBJETO), esta operación se hace en primer plano provocando que el usuario tenga que esperar para mostrar dicha información.
  • No hay ningún problema en mostrar campos de maestro ya que estos son cargados en segundo plano sin retrasar la carga de la rejilla.
  • Variables en disco

Las rejillas deben moverse fluidas en todo momento, si notas que una rejilla de tu aplicación es mucho más lenta de lo habitual, posiblemente tiene alguno de los detalles comentados anteriormente.Importante recordar que es aconsejable realizar tus desarrollos orientados a la nube, aunque tu proyecto se ejecute en un cliente en red local. Al desarrollar y probar en la nube se detectan los detalles mucho más fácilmente. En local suele ir más de 20 veces más rápido al tener una latencia mucho menor.

Regístrate ahora y nuestro equipo se pondrá en contacto muy pronto